CAMERON, Mo. – Kenneth Allen Sloan, 74, passed away March 9, 2024.

Kenny was born Nov. 1, 1949, to Harold and Laura (Harper) Sloan and raised in Turney, Missouri. He was a 1968 graduate of Osborn High School.

Kenny spent most of his life as “just a farm boy” as he always said. He loved “red” tractors, farming with his dad’s team of mules and giving the kids hay rides when the work was done. Kenny shared many stories about his time farming with those mules and the ‘ole tractor.

Kenny enjoyed kids, and even though he had none of his own, he enjoyed his nieces and nephews. Kenny was well known in the community. He never knew a stranger. He always had time to visit and see how you were doing. He loved getting together with his buddies for breakfast to catch up on the latest news.

Kenny will be missed by his family and friends.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Harold and Laura; sister, Joyce Brandon; sister-in-law, Bobbi Sloan (wife of Jack Sloan).

Kenny is survived by his siblings, Loren and Sharon Sloan, Osborn, Missouri, Jack Sloan, Colorado Springs, Colorado, Faye Crockett, Osborn, Ival and Lois Snow, Osborn, Jim and Pam Sloan, Gladstone, Missouri, Sherry Sloan, Everett, Washington; nieces and nephews.
